S2 Ep 102: Redefining Confidence: Building Skills To True Self-Belief in The Saddle

Beyond the Bridle

In this episode, we dive into the hard stuff—the kind of raw that doesn’t feel polished or perfect. McKayla shares her experience of finding time to rest while being sick, despite the push to keep moving like everything’s fine, while Camri opens up about a wonky trail ride with Freya and the confidence it took to hold steady.

Using these reflections as our starting point, we’re taking a deeper look at confidence in the saddle and beyond. Is confidence just about skill, or is there something more to it? We explore the differences between bravery and self-belief, how technical skills alone can’t guarantee lasting confidence, and why true self-confidence means trusting yourself—even when things go wrong. We also touch on imposter syndrome, the weight of external validation, and why leaning into your own self-belief matters just as much as mastering technique.

Tune in for an honest conversation on redefining confidence, the ups and downs of finding your footing, and why self-trust is the foundation for riding—and living—boldly.
